Keck Ridge
Keck Ridge is a ridge in Hocking, Ohio and has an elevation of 1,020 feet. Keck Ridge is situated nearby to the hamlet South Bloomingville, as well as near Cedar Grove.Places in the Area

South Bloomingville
Hamlet
South Bloomingville is an unincorporated community in western Benton Township, Hocking County, Ohio, United States. Although it is unincorporated, it has a zip code of 43152.
Hocking Hills

The Hocking Hills is a deeply dissected area of the Allegheny Plateau in Appalachian Ohio, primarily in Hocking County, that features cliffs, gorges, rock shelters, and waterfalls.
